LDRM specializes in background investigation support, records management, business automation and optimization, and administrative support. Responsibilities

Conducts research on cases prior to these being sent for adjudication by gathering information from a variety of sources. Evaluates data sets and interpret the relevance of data gathered. Performs analyses on research conducted and information received. Ensures the integrity of record keeping systems. Writes reports in a clear and concise manner. Coordinates and networks with agency personnel. Appropriately handles Law Enforcement Sensitive information. Performs analyses on petitions. Identifies errors and areas for improvement. Maintains a working knowledge of eligibility requirements. May be required to perform other duties as assigned. Makes phone calls to collect information. Evaluates the case at hand and execute communication. Qualifications

1-2 years of related experience. High School degree or equivalent. Ability to successfully complete a pre-employment background investigation. Ability to obtain and maintain a Secret government security clearance. Additional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ities: Ability to communicate effectively orally and in writing in English. Ability to communicate effectively orally and in writing in Spanish (preferred). Ability to prepare reports and analyze documents. Ability to establish effective communications. Ability to use databases for the purpose of obtaining and validating information. Ability to comprehend government regulations. Ability to conduct telephonic interviews. Ability to analyze and evaluate data. Physical Demands

LDRM, a joint venture comprised of Lockwood Hills Federal, an Akima company, and DTSV, is not just another technical support contractor. As an Alaska Native Corporation (ANC), our mission and purpose extend beyond our exciting federal projects as we support our shareholder communities in Alaska. At LDRM, the work you do every day makes a difference in the lives of our 15,000 Iupiat shareholders, a group of Alaska natives from one of the most remote and harshest environments in the United States. For our shareholders, LDRM provides support and employment opportunities and contributes to the survival of a culture that has thrived above the Arctic Circle for more than 10,000 years. For our government customers, LDRM provides technical, operational, and administrative support services to federal agencies, including Department of State and the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office.
